Josephine Ninesling 1903 - 1986

Josephine Ninesling of Great Neck, Nassau County, NY was born on January 8, 1903, and died at age 83 years old on February 22, 1986. Josephine Ninesling was buried at Long Island National Cemetery Section 2J Site 2276 2040 Wellwood Avenue, in Farmingdale.

Did you know?
In 1903, in the year that Josephine Ninesling was born, the silent film, The Great Train Robbery opened. Although it was filmed in Milltown, New Jersey, it was a Western. Twelve minutes long, the film used a lot of innovative techniques - some scenes were hand colored and composite editing, on-location shooting, and frequent camera movement were used. Its budget was $150 (about $4000 currently) and was the most popular film until 1915 when Birth of a Nation was released.
Did you know?
In 1928, Josephine was 25 years old when aviatrix Amelia Earhart, age 31, became the first woman to fly solo across North America and back in August. In June, she had been part of a 3 man crew that flew the Atlantic Ocean but since she had no instrument training, she couldn't fly the plane - she kept the flight log. The North American flight became one of her many "firsts" as a female pilot.
